From plastic bales to food-grade recyclate
Krones Recycling’s systems cover the entire plastics process chain – from sorting and shredding to washing and decontamination. The MetaPure washing module plays a key role in this, as it is essential for determining the quality of the flakes produced in terms of purity, odourlessness and suitability for food law applications. Virtually residue-free cleaning is crucial, especially for bottle-to-bottle processes, as only absolutely clean flakes are approved for direct contact with food.
Efficiency in the smallest of spaces
The new MetaPure Compact was specially designed for production environments with limited space. Krones says that it significantly reduces the space required without compromising the washing quality compared to larger reference systems. The machine is designed for gentle processing, which largely avoids the formation of fine particles – a crucial aspect, as flakes of less than 2 mm are usually ejected from the process and thus economically lost. In addition to the material-friendly washing profile, the machine is energy-efficient and has a water-saving process. Made of stainless steel, the MetaPure Compact is suitable for processing PET bottles and HDPE and, thanks to its consistently high washing quality, can be easily used for bottle-to-bottle processes. Due to the gentle process, it is claimed to be particularly suitable for brittle materials such as PET trays, PP and PS because the production of fines is minimised. With input capacities of around 1.5 and 6 t/h, the MetaPure Compact addresses both compact locations with limited space and retrofits in existing buildings where additional square meters are simply not available.
Flexible adaptation
In its standard version, the compact configuration covers all requirements for a washing module at attractive conditions and can be installed and commissioned under shorter project durations. At the same time, a modular catalogue of options allows specific functions to be added as required – from process-related adjustments to monitoring and service packages. The compact design has a direct impact on the total cost of ownership: it reduces space requirements as well as energy and water consumption, shortens pipe routes and reduces installation and maintenance costs. All these factors help to minimise the total cost of ownership and facilitate economic use, especially in markets with high cost and space pressure.
Proven technology with a new structure
Parallel to the compact version, a second product line remains in the range, which covers an equally important need for many customers. The new MetaPure Performance, based on the previous MetaPure W, is aimed at complex application scenarios that require very high system availability and robust behaviour in demanding operation – for example, when different products are processed on the same line. In order to meet these requirements even better in the future, targeted optimisations have been made. The module now works more efficiently – with consistently low fines production and excellent washing results, says the company.
Expansion of the range of materials
With a view to future requirements, Krones Recycling is consistently expanding its range of materials. A solution for the efficient washing of LDPE – and thus for a large segment of film and bag materials – is also available and will be presented shortly. For special applications or complex material combinations, the company’s own Recycling Technology Center is also available. There, material characterisations, feasibility studies and process optimisations can be carried out under realistic conditions in order to secure the optimal system configuration based on data before large-scale investments are made.
